Transaction 4fac61c9eea314782fcd7070204a1459a8253ce197ed625f4c7c832d4bde8cd8

1 Input
2 Outputs
  • 4fac61c9eea314782fcd7070204a1459a8253ce197ed625f4c7c832d4bde8cd8:0
  • value  23925766675
    address  1FTyEyCvZ7GjagoUybo3fbRpeGZsfVTVEv
  • 4fac61c9eea314782fcd7070204a1459a8253ce197ed625f4c7c832d4bde8cd8:1
  • value  129417200
    address  1BWPkhrkXGt1kjjUUUPMYpt1Bw4aCnBjTF